DEPARTMENT OVERVIEW

The Smarter Balanced Assessment Consortium (SBAC) is a public agency supported by 15 members (13 states, one territory and the Bureau of Indian Education). Through the work of thousands of educators, Smarter Balanced created an online assessment system aligned to the Common Core State Standards (CCSS), as well as tools for educators to improve teaching and learning. Smarter Balanced is housed at the University of California Santa Cruz (UCSC) Silicon Valley Extension. Our work is guided by the belief that a high-quality assessment system can provide information and tools for teachers and schools to improve instruction and help students succeed - regardless of disability, language, or subgroup. We involve experienced educators, researchers, state and local policymakers, and community groups working together in a transparent and consensus-driven process.

JOB SUMMARY

Independently oversees a comprehensive communications program for a unit or school with moderately complex communications requirements. The communications program usually includes written, visual, digital and electronic communications. Works with management to develop and execute organizational communication and market branding strategy. Designs and implements information campaigns.

The communications specialist serves as a collaborative team member of the communications and member services teams in a remote context to support external communication projects and to facilitate member related events and correspondence. The incumbent utilizes organizational skills and attention to detail to manage and track multiple tasks with limited supervision.

JOB DUTIES

10% - Works with management and members to develop, and implement long and short term strategic communications plans and / or projects.

20% - Coordinates communications materials, including written, visual, digital, and electronic communications.

15% - Supports implementation of effective systems for managing information, projects and communications to ensure accurate and timely responses. Identifies specific communications needs and develops the content and process for organizational improvements.

15% - Coordinates and tracks information from other teams to ensure completion and sufficient time for leadership review in advance of project due dates.

10% - Maintains and updates technical documents and Content Management Systems (CMS).

15% - Coordinates team's business activities including scheduling, travel planning, meeting coordination for Consortium and team events, and committee and advisory groups.

10% - Assists with event planning including site selection, logistics, and working with vendors on event planning, scheduling, and site preparation.

5% - Performs specific projects or assignments.
